Carrots, potatoes, and nether wart will multiply, wheat will get longer, and melons and pumpkins will grow a block. If you have bone meal, you can use it on the crop to instantly make it grow and be ready for harvest.How long does it take a crop to grow in Minecraft?
For the fastest growth per seed, a full layer of hydrated farmland with crops in rows is ideal. Under these conditions, the probability of growth during each update is 1⁄3, or approximately 33%. Most (4⁄5) planted crops reach maturity within 31 minutes (about 1.5 minecraft days).Why won't my seeds grow on Minecraft?
Your crops need the proper soil and adequate light. Ensure the soil is tilled, and always plant in well-lit areas (unless you're planting mushrooms). What grows faster wheat or carrots in Minecraft?
Sugar canes and cactus grow the fastest. If you are referring to only crops for food, then carrots and potatoes will grow the most food in a given amount of time.Why are my carrots not growing in Minecraft?
Planted carrots require a light level of 9 or greater to continue growing. If the light level is 7 or below, the crops instantly un-plant themselves ("pop off"). It is not possible to plant carrots if the light level is too low. Crops grow faster if the farmland they are planted in is hydrated.Why are my seeds taking so long to grow in Minecraft?

Actually, minecraft crops don't need sunlight. You can just use artificial light like torch, redstone ramp, whatever you want. This makes underground farm with roof made of non-transparent block possible.Does sleeping in Minecraft make crops grow faster?
Edit heres a bit from the wiki on it . Sleeping only changes the time of day to sunrise; it does not speed up processes which take place over time such as the decay of dropped items, plant growth, and smelting.Does Glowstone make crops grow faster?

One full day and night cycle in Minecraft takes exactly 20 minutes. That comes out to three in game days per real-world hour. Days and nights last equal amounts of time, that being 10 minutes, with the ability to sleep beginning once the time ticks over that 10-minute mark.How much light does Glowstone give off?
Glowstone's most obvious feature is that it glows - emitting a light level of 15, making it the joint-brightest block in the game, alongside sea lanterns, beacons, jack o'lanterns and redstone lamps (which themselves are crafted from glowstone).What is the max age of wheat in Minecraft?
